C/C++雜記:虛函數的實現的基本原理 虛函數表

Malecrab   博客園 首頁 新隨筆 聯繫 訂閱 管理 C/C++雜記:虛函數的實現的基本原理 1. 概述 簡單地說,每一個含有虛函數(無論是其本身的,還是繼承而來的)的類都至少有一個與之對應的虛函數表,其中存放着該類所有的虛函數對應的函數指針。例: 其中: B的虛函數表中存放着B::foo和B::bar兩個函數指針。 D的虛函數表中存放的既有繼承自B的虛函數B::foo,又有重寫(over
相關文章
相關標籤/搜索